“It’s a good thing.”

That’s the reaction from La Broquerie’s fire chief in hearing about province announcing more cancers are added to the list of diseases that firefighters can claim coverage for under the Workers Compensation Act.

Al Nadeau says it’s good to hear the acknowledgement of the increased health risk for firefighters and the work they're doing.

“We are exposed to many more things than the average person,” he says, adding that he’s hearing positive reaction to the announcement.

When a firefighter is diagnosed with one of the 19 cancers that are now on the list, it will be presumed to be an occupational disease unless the contrary is proven.
